Senate mourns travelers burnt to death by bandits

The Senate, on Wednesday, mourned the deaths of travelers burnt to ashes on Monday by suspected bandits on their way to Gayan in Kaduna State.

The travelers numbering 23, according to reports, were attacked in Angwan Bawa, Sabin Gari Local Government Area of Sokoto State.

Coming under order 43 of the Senate Rules, Sen. Ibrahim Gobir (Sokoto East), drew the attention of his colleagues to the gruesome murder of the travelers.

He lamented the spate of killings, which, he warned were alarming and on the increase.

He called on the military and security agencies to immediately intervene by deploying personnel to secure the lives of residents in states affected by the activities of bandits.

The Senate, thereafter, observed a minute silence to mourn the victims of Monday’s attack by bandits.
